Vehicle Speed Control problem #1

Vehicle was driven 1. 2 miles for first run of the day. Temp was 48 f. Car was in drive at stoplight when engine accelerated beyond max rpm. Car lunged forward into intersection and a lot of effort had to be applied to brake to keed car from going any further. Driver grabbed gear shifter and shifted to neutral and having slipped into reverse. Engine rpm then subsided and vehicle was then driven 14 miles with no further incidence.

Vehicle Speed Control problem #2

Car hesitates when accelerator pedal is applied after coming to a stop or when attempting to pass other vehicles. Especially frequent at turns from a complete stop eg turning into or across moving traffic. The car initially moves forward and then all forward movement stops. The engine does not appear to die the rpm's stay constant but the gas pedal has no effect and the car simply rolls to a stop at low speeds or slows up considerably at higher speeds. The result is that you are left either straddled across a couple of lanes of oncoming traffic if you tried to turn left or you are stalling in front of traffic traveling in the same direction as you or you are hung out to dry at higher speeds in the wrong lane of a two lane highway. It happens frequently but it does not happen constantly. You just never know when it is going to happen. It is extremely dangerous and the dealer says that all the Minis are the same and that , that is just the way they handle. Well it didn't handle like that when I got it and it only handles that way a few times a day.
